Living Writers: Giannina Braschi
Living Writers: Giannina Braschi
Giannina Braschi was born in San Juan, Puerto Rico. She was a fashion model, singer, and tennis champion in her teen years. She studied literature in Madrid, Rome, London, and Rouen before settling in New York City.
